Madagascar's Baobab Tree Tsitakakantsa

The Giant Baobab Tree Tsitakakantsa is located in Madagascar. At an estimated age of 900 years, this tree is a marvel of nature. Tsitakakantsa towers over the landscape, with a circumference of up to 29 meters. It is not just its size that sets this tree apart, but also the complex relationship between its grandeur and its decay.

The Biology of Baobabs

Baobab trees are renowned for their distinctive shape, with thick trunks and branchless stems. These trees store water in their trunks, enabling them to survive in harsh, arid environments. Baobabs are native to the savannas and dry woodlands of Africa, where they can reach heights of up to 30 meters and live for thousands of years.

The Current State of Tsitakakantsa

Rapid Decay and Deterioration

Tsitakakantsa is currently in a state of rapid decay. Despite its age, the tree has been deteriorating rapidly in recent years. This decay is evident in the crumbling bark and the weakening of its structure. Scientists and conservationists are studying the tree to understand the factors contributing to its decline. Environmental changes, climate shifts, and increasing human activity around the tree are potential causes.

Potential Collapse

The current state of Tsitakakantsa raises concerns about its potential collapse in the near future. The tree's decaying condition suggests that it may not be able to withstand environmental stressors for much longer. This possibility has heightened the urgency for conservation efforts to preserve the tree and the surrounding ecosystem.
